Focus on ontology evolution as the intellectual framework of our efforts to address evolving semantics & semantic drift
...the process of adaptation of an ontology to arisen changes in the corresponding domain while maintaining both the consistency of the ontology itself as well as the consistency of depending artifacts. [1]

Ct = < labelt(C), intt(C), extt(C) >
◦ label = human-readable string
◦ intension = set of properties related to a concept
◦ extension = set of things a concept extends to
